Introduce Variety: Ensure a balanced diet plan by integrating different food types. This not only offers nutrition but also keeps your parrot engaged.
Monitor Portions: Use appropriate part sizes to avoid weight problems. This is especially crucial for high-calorie foods like nuts.
Tidy Water: Always offer fresh, clean water. Hydration is just as essential as food.
Prevent Toxic Foods: Certain foods can be hazardous to parrots. Foods like chocolate, avocado, and caffeine ought to be strictly prevented.
Seek advice from with a Veterinarian: Regular check-ups can assist recognize any dietary shortages or health problems early on.
Typical Questions About Parrot FoodFAQ
Can I feed my parrot only seeds?
While seeds can be a part of a parrot's diet plan, relying solely on them can cause nutritional deficiencies. A well balanced diet plan must consist of pellets, fresh fruits, and vegetables.
How frequently should I feed my parrot vegetables and fruits?
Fresh vegetables and fruits need to be offered daily. Go for a variety to keep meals interesting and nutritious.
What are the signs of an unhealthy diet Graupapageien In Deutschland Kaufen my parrot?
Signs of an unhealthy diet plan might include feather plucking, dull feathers, weight loss, and reduced activity levels.
Is it safe to offer my parrot human food?
Some human foods can be safe (like cooked grains), while others can be harmful (such as chocolate or caffeine). Constantly research study before sharing.
How can I get my parrot to consume pellets?
Slowly present pellets by mixing them with seeds. You can also try various brands or tastes to find what your bird prefers.
